如何创建:速度转换器

学习如何使用 HTM L和 JavaScript 创建一个速度转换器。

速度转换器

在任意字段中键入一个值,可在速度度量之间进行转换:

Buat pengkonversi kecepatan

Buat elemen input yang dapat mengkonversi unit kecepatan satu ke yang lain.

Langkah pertama - Tambahkan HTML:

<p>
  <label>MPH</label>
  <input id="inputMPH" type="number" placeholder="MPH"
  oninput="speedConverter(this.value)"
  onchange="speedConverter(this.value)"
</p>
<p>KPH: <span id="outputKPH"></span></p>

Langkah kedua - Tambahkan JavaScript:

Miles per hour ke kilometer per jam:

/* Ketika bidang input menerima input, konversi nilai dari mph ke kph */
function speedConverter(valNum) {
  valNum = parseFloat(valNum);
  document.getElementById("outputKPH").innerHTML = valNum * 1.609344;
}

Coba sendiri

Konversi MPH ke unit kecepatan lainnya

Tabel di bawah ini menunjukkan bagaimana mengkonversi MPH ke unit kecepatan lainnya:

Deskripsi Formulir Contoh
Konversi MPH ke KPH KPH = MPH * 1.609344 Coba sendiri
Konversi MPH ke knot knot = MPH / 1.150779 Coba sendiri
Konversi MPH ke Mach Mach = MPH / 761.207 Coba sendiri

Konversi KPH ke unit kecepatan lainnya

Tabel di bawah ini menunjukkan bagaimana mengkonversi KPH ke unit kecepatan lainnya:

Deskripsi Formulir Contoh
Konversi KPH ke MPH MPH = KPH / 1.609344 Coba sendiri
Konversi KPH ke knot knot = KPH / 1.852 Coba sendiri
Konversi KPH ke Mach Mach = KPH / 1225.044 Coba sendiri

Konversi knot ke unit kecepatan lainnya

Tabel di bawah ini menunjukkan bagaimana mengkonversi knot ke unit kecepatan lainnya:

Deskripsi Formulir Contoh
Konversi knot ke MPH MPH = knot * 1.150779 Coba sendiri
Konversi knot ke KPH KPH = knot * 1.852 Coba sendiri
Konversi knot ke Mach Mach = knot / 661.4708 Coba sendiri

Konversi Mach ke unit kecepatan lainnya

Tabel di bawah ini menunjukkan bagaimana mengkonversi angka Mach ke unit kecepatan lainnya:

Deskripsi Formulir Contoh
Konversi Mach ke MPH MPH = Mach * 761.207 Coba sendiri
Konversi Mach ke KPH KPH=Mach*1225.044 Coba sendiri
Konversi Mach ke knot knots=Mach*661.4708 Coba sendiri